How do I use Autel IM608 to do key fob programming?

The Programming application requires connection between the Autel IM608 and the XP400, and no vehicle connection is required. This application can access the key chip, read, retrieve and write key information, as well as other key related functions.

Select the vehicle manufacturer in the vehicle menu, and then follow the onscreen instructions to select the instrument information to display the function menu.

Chip Read & Write

1. Select Chip Read & Write from the menu.

2. Select the chip type if needed. In this example, select EEPROM.

3. The screen displays the types of EEPROM supported. Select the right type.

4. Select Read Operation on the next menu.

5. The chip data screen displays. Select Save to save the data, or select Cancel to exit.

6. Type the file name and select Confirm, the chip data will be saved on the tablet. And a “File saved successfully.” message displays.

7. Select Write Operation from the operations menu. The tablet will open the default folder, select the saved data and click Confirm to write it into a black chip. And a “Chip written successfully.” message displays.
